Note: I highly recommend renting a car to explore the Tuscan countryside. It makes getting from one spot to the next so much easier and more flexible. We picked ours up at the Florence airport (it’s just a quick cab ride if you come by train!), and the best part is it’s on the outskirts of the city, so you skip the hassle of driving in Florence itself and are practically already in the countryside. Don’t worry, Italians drive on the right side of the road, just like in the US! Once you’re out in the hills, driving is easy and gives you the freedom to explore at your own pace. Where Is The Tuscany Region In Italy

Tuscany sits right in the heart of Italy, bordered by Liguria, Emilia-Romagna, Umbria, Marche, Lazio, and the Tyrrhenian Sea. This central location gives Tuscany a diverse landscape, with everything from rolling inland hills to beautiful coastline, and it makes it easy to explore.

Is Tuscany Region Safe?

Yes, Tuscany is generally very safe for travelers! The region has a low crime rate, especially in smaller towns and rural areas, where tourism and local life blend together seamlessly. Florence, Siena, and Pisa are well-patrolled. But, like any popular destination, it’s smart to stay alert in crowded areas and keep an eye out for pickpockets near major tourist attractions and train stations. Whether you’re wandering through the countryside or exploring the historic city centers, Tuscany offers a relaxed, safe environment for solo travelers, couples, and families. Castello Vicchiomaggio

If you’re looking for the perfect place to stay in the heart of the Chianti region, Castello Vicchiomaggio is everything you could dream of and more. Nestled among the rolling hills of Greve in Chianti, this stunning property offers panoramic views, award-winning wines, and the ultimate Tuscan getaway experience. We had the pleasure of staying on the property. And I can honestly say it was one of the highlights of our trip. If I could go back tomorrow, I would in a heartbeat.

The wine tasting took place on a gorgeous terrace overlooking the vineyard, with sweeping views of the countryside that made each sip feel extra special. There’s something about sipping fine wine while watching the sun set over endless hills that truly embodies the magic of Tuscany.

The property itself is a perfect mix of charm and luxury.

Our room was spacious, peaceful, and beautifully appointed, offering everything you need for a relaxing stay. The real highlight was the infinity pool that overlooked the Tuscan hills—imagine soaking in the Tuscan sun during golden hour, with a glass of wine in hand. Each morning, we were treated to a breakfast spread brimming with fresh fruit, pastries, and savory bites that fueled us up for a day of adventure.

Beyond the comfort and beauty of the property, Castello Vicchiomaggio is the ideal home base for exploring the Chianti Classico region. After long afternoons of wine tasting and wandering the picturesque streets of nearby towns, coming back to this peaceful retreat felt like a dream. Whether you’re after a romantic escape, a wine-lover’s paradise, a family trip, or simply a place to unwind and soak in Tuscany’s beauty, Castello Vicchiomaggio is everything you’re looking for and more.

  • Best for: Staying in wine country, infinity pool views, on-site dining
  • Location: Greve in Chianti

Borgo Santo Pietro

If you’re looking for a luxurious, five-star escape in Southern Tuscany, Borgo Santo Pietro is the ultimate retreat. Situated near Siena, just over an hour from Florence, this estate blends historic charm with modern comfort. The property offers individually designed rooms, private pool suites, and exclusive villas, all surrounded by vineyards, olive groves, and beautiful gardens.

Dining here is a treat—whether you’re enjoying gourmet meals at the Michelin-starred Saporium or savoring a more casual bite at Trattoria Sull’Albero. You can indulge in spa treatments, take part in wine tastings, or even explore the stunning countryside on Vespas. The resort is not only luxurious but also safe and accessible. They have airport transfers and private parking available for added convenience.

  • Best for: Luxury, Michelin-star dining, private villas, wellness experiences
  • Location: Near Siena, about an hour from Florence

Hotel Bel Soggiorno 

Hotel Bel Soggiorno is the perfect blend of convenience and charm, located right in San Gimignano, with breathtaking views of the Tuscan countryside. This hotel gives you the best of both worlds—you’re just a short walk from the town’s iconic medieval center. Yet, you can also enjoy the serenity of the surrounding hills.

The hotel offers rooms with options for either countryside views or city views, so you can pick your perfect setting. Whether you’re waking up to the rolling hills of Tuscany or the beautiful city skyline, the views here will make your stay even more magical.

San Gimignano is a UNESCO World Heritage town, famous for its medieval towers and charming cobblestone streets. It’s often referred to as the “Manhattan of Tuscany” due to its impressive skyline of towers that date back to the 12th century. Staying at Hotel Bel Soggiorno gives you easy access to explore this historic gem while also providing a peaceful retreat when you’re ready to relax.

  • Best for: Stunning views, central city location, exploring San Gimignano
  • Location: Right in San Gimignano, walking distance to the historic center
